Directional steering at compact SWaP scale.

MAGIC ELF is a small-form-factor, interference-mitigating drop-in replacement for omnidirectional antennas — 250 g, <600 mW, no moving parts — engineered for size- and weight-constrained applications where larger steerable antennas don't fit.

Steering is fully electronic, enabled by Notch's reconfigurable metamaterial architecture. Beam patterns are software-controlled and configurable per platform without hardware redesign — directional, multi-beam, or interference-resilient configurations on demand.
